1. 什么是自動增長
自動增長是指在插入數據時,MySQL會自動為id字段賦一個新的值,通常是當前最大值加1。這種方式可以確保id的唯一性,同時也節省了手動輸入id的時間和精力。
2. 自動增長的優點
自動增長的優點主要有以下幾點:
(1)確保數據的唯一性和完整性,避免數據重復和錯誤。
(2)節省手動輸入id的時間和精力,提高數據的插入效率。
(3)方便數據的管理和查詢,避免id的間斷和混亂。
3. 自動增長的設置方法
在MySQL中,設置自動增長的方法很簡單,只需要在創建表時,將id字段的屬性設為自增長即可。具體步驟如下:
(1)打開MySQL命令行或客戶端,輸入以下命令創建一個新表:
CREATE TABLE `test` (t(11) NOT NULL AUTO_INCREMENT,ame` varchar(20) NOT NULL,t(11) NOT NULL,
PRIMARY KEY (`id`)noDB DEFAULT CHARSET=utf8;
(2)在創建表的過程中,將id字段的屬性設為自增長,方法是在id字段后面加上AUTO_INCREMENT關鍵字。
(3)執行以上命令后,就成功創建了一個名為test的新表,其中id字段已經被設為自增長。此時,每次插入數據時,都會自動為id字段賦一個新的值。
4. 總結
自動增長是MySQL數據庫中常用的一種id設置方式,可以確保數據的唯一性和完整性,節省手動輸入id的時間和精力,方便數據的管理和查詢。通過以上介紹,相信大家已經掌握了自動增長的設置方法和優點,可以在實際應用中靈活運用,讓數據庫管理更加輕松。